Webster's 1828 Dictionary

GRINDER, n. One that grinds, or moves a mill.
1. The instrument of grinding.
2. A tooth that grinds or chews food; a double tooth; a jaw-tooth.
3. The teeth in general.

WordNet (r) 3.0 (2005)

n
1: a large sandwich made of a long crusty roll split lengthwise and filled with meats and cheese (and tomato and onion and lettuce and condiments); different names are used in different sections of the United States [syn: bomber, grinder, hero, hero sandwich, hoagie, hoagy, Cuban sandwich, Italian sandwich, poor boy, sub, submarine, submarine sandwich, torpedo, wedge, zep]
2: grinding tooth with a broad crown; located behind the premolars [syn: molar, grinder]
3: machinery that processes materials by grinding or crushing [syn: mill, grinder, milling machinery]
4: a machine tool that polishes metal

Merriam Webster's

noun Date: 14th century 1. a. molar b. plural teeth 2. one that grinds 3. a machine or device for grinding 4. submarine 2 5. an athlete who succeeds through hard work and determination rather than exceptional skill

Oxford Reference Dictionary

n. 1 a person or thing that grinds, esp. a machine (often in comb.: coffee-grinder; organ-grinder). 2 a molar tooth.

Webster's 1913 Dictionary

Grinder Grind"er, n. 1. One who, or that which, grinds. 2. One of the double teeth, used to grind or masticate the food; a molar. 3. (Zo["o]l.) The restless flycatcher (Seisura inquieta) of Australia; -- called also restless thrush and volatile thrush. It makes a noise like a scissors grinder, to which the name alludes.

Collin's Cobuild Dictionary

(grinders) 1. In a kitchen, a grinder is a device for crushing food such as coffee or meat into small pieces or into a powder. ...an electric coffee grinder. N-COUNT: oft n N 2. A grinder is a machine or tool for sharpening, smoothing, or polishing the surface of something. N-COUNT: oft supp N
